Africa - Urgent Mpox Outbreak 2024

August 14 , 2024 16 hrs 0 min 12 0
  • Monkeypox outbreak began in Democratic Republic of Congo but has now spread over nine other African countries including Burundi, Central African Republic, Rwanda and South Africa.
  • The mpox outbreak was last reported during 2022-23 and has intensified since then.
  • The infection is similar to smallpox which was effectively eradicated in 1980.
  • But mpox has continued to make headlines in central and west Africa.
  • Historically, the first human case of mpox was recorded in DRC in 1970.
  • Mpox is a zoonosis, a disease that is transmitted from animals to humans.
